Frozen Yogurt Cookie Dough Oat Bites

Ingredients
  

1 cup rolled oats

1/2 cup almond flour

1/2 cup almond butter (or peanut butter)

1/4 cup honey or maple syrup

1 teaspoon vanilla extract

1/4 teaspoon salt

1/2 cup mini chocolate chips

1 cup Greek yogurt (preferably non-fat or low-fat)

1/4 cup sweetener of choice (if desired, adjust based on yogurt tartness)

Toppings: crushed nuts, shredded coconut, or additional chocolate chips (optional)

Instructions
 

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the rolled oats, almond flour, and salt. Stir well to ensure the dry ingredients are evenly mixed.

    Combine Wet Ingredients: In a separate bowl, mix together the almond butter, honey (or maple syrup), and vanilla extract until smooth and creamy.

      Combine Mixtures: Pour the wet mixture into the bowl with the dry ingredients. Mix until well combined. If the mixture feels too crumbly, add a splash of water or additional honey/maple syrup to help bind it together.

        Add Chocolate Chips: Gently fold in the mini chocolate chips into the dough. You can reserve a few for topping later if you’d like.

          Shape the Bites: Using your hands, scoop out small portions of the dough and roll them into small balls (about 1 inch in diameter). Place each ball on a parchment-lined baking tray.

            Prepare Yogurt Coating: In a small bowl, stir the Greek yogurt and sweetener (if using) until smooth.

              Coat the Bites: Dip each energy bite into the yogurt mixture, ensuring they are completely coated. Use a fork to lift them out and allow the excess to drip off before returning them to the baking tray.

                Freeze: Once all bites are coated, place the tray in the freezer for about 2 hours or until fully frozen.

                  Serve and Enjoy: Once frozen, you can eat them as is or sprinkle with additional toppings of your choice (crushed nuts, shredded coconut, or extra chocolate chips).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the freezer.

                    Prep Time: 15 minutes | Total Time: 2 hours 15 minutes | Servings: 12-15 bites
